Welcome Vampyre Master! On the Hind subject, have you tried changing the compatibility setting of the install program? You can actually right click on the setup icon on the Hind CD, go to properties, and change the compatibility to Windows 98/95. That might help you get it going again. It has worked for many of my old games. Tom Clancy's SSN wouldn't run in XP either until I actually installed it with the install program being run in 98/95 compatibility mode.
